(Bio)Semiotic Theory of Translation
Discover the innovative insights of the (Bio)Semiotic Theory of Translation by Taylor & Francis Ltd, published in 2020. This thought-provoking volume spans 208 pages and presents a unique perspective on translation theory through the lens of Peircean semiotics. Unlike traditional approaches that prioritize language, this book explores a broader understanding of translation, encompassing various instances beyond mere linguistic interpretation.
